You can install with chameleon boot loader first and then use the installer version of clover to test it with a USB drive and boot from the USB. Then once you are sure with your customizations with the installer you can directly install it later to your mavericks partition or harddisk. I assume that you might have gone through some guides from insanelymac or osx86. So the basic idea is to get a working mavericks installation in the standard method and then replace the bootloader using clover v.2

Ok I'm up to the step where I have to Configuring Clover. I've made the USB Stick even thou I don't won't to boot from the stick but I've heard I have to do this first to try it out. 

 

It's asking me to copy my kexts to /EFI/CLOVER/KEXTS/10.9. But where do I find my Kexts files ? 

Link to comment
Share on other sites

For the beginning try to boot just with NullCPUPowerManagement.kext and FakeSMC.kext.

 

Have you recognized the Download section in the top menu?

 

For giving you advice what kexts you need other users should know what hardware you use...
